Early Retirement Options A teacher who has reached the age of 55 and has 35 years pensionable service may retire on pension. Your gratuity is not liable for income tax but teachers who opted into the Spouses and Childrens scheme will be liable for a reduction of 1% of retiring salary for each years reckonable service for which no contributions have been made. A Disability Pension is payable to a teacher who fulfils minimum service requirements and whose employer is satisfied that due to infirmity the teacher is not capable of performing his/her duties and the infirmity is likely to be permanent. Additional Voluntary Contributions (AVCs) Members who will not complete full service at retirement because they: started teaching/lecturing late, took a career break, job shared, are retiring early, availed of a marriage gratuity and as a result will qualify for reduced pension and gratuity may, subject to Revenue maximum benefits, make contributions to the TUI AVC Plan in order to enhance their Pension and Gratuity Benefits at retirement. Under the current rules of the scheme you may only purchase the service that you will be missing at age 65 (or 60 for teachers employed in community or comprehensive schools). Spouses' and Childrens' Pensions Scheme If you should die after retirement on pension, your widow/widower is entitled to half the pension you were receiving and a survivors pension provided you contributed the additional 1 1/2% of salary. On the other hand, pension arising from service purchased under this scheme increases/decreases with pay of serving peers unlike pensions purchased under AVC, PRSA or other private schemes which normally rise with inflation subject to a maximum increase of 3% per year. 7. As it is no longer possible to avail of tax allowances on pension contributions over the previous ten years, members purchasing by instalment are advised to begin purchase as early as possible and to purchase by lump sum at the earliest date allowed. In the case of a teacher or lecturer paying D Rate PRSI, the pension is 1/80th of a teachers pensionable remuneration for each year of pensionable service.
